Transaction 35fe563a0145846f3f7cdc73685e2e768f76317ff40bbd59ab65974a027f3a84

1 Input
2 Outputs
  • 35fe563a0145846f3f7cdc73685e2e768f76317ff40bbd59ab65974a027f3a84:0
  • value  77092
    address  3QafCA6sesM4HeAtFHCGfSRrjbejQAGfpv
  • 35fe563a0145846f3f7cdc73685e2e768f76317ff40bbd59ab65974a027f3a84:1
  • value  11236366
    address  bc1q62edallrezu87ehuuappvxx3002uytdgfrc8dq00s66kzjhpatnqgtqexv